About HAM OFF THE BONE
HAM OFF THE BONE is a moderate-calorie food with 143 calories per 100-gram serving. Its primary macronutrient source is protein, providing 17.9g of protein, 1.8g of carbohydrates, and 6.3g of fat. This food belongs to the Pepperoni, Salami & Cold Cuts category.
Ingredients
CURED WITH WATER, CONTAINS 2% OR LESS OF SALT, SUGAR, POTASSIUM LACTATE, SODIUM LACTATE, SODIUM PHOSPHATES, SODIUM DIACETATE, SODIUM ERYTHORBATE, SODIUM NITRITE.

Calorie Breakdown
At 143 calories per 100 grams, HAM OFF THE BONE gets 50% of its calories from protein, 5% from carbohydrates, and 39% from fat. This is moderate, similar to many lean proteins and whole grains.
